--- Comment #17 from RedBearAK <redb...@redbearnet.com> --- Something has changed after a Tumbleweed update, even though none of the Plasma/Qt version info in "About" has changed. It used to be Plasmashell using about 17% CPU, with kwin_wayland using about 15%, and Plasmashell would pretty consistently crash if it was busy when quitting the GTK app (GNOME Text Editor or Apostrophe). But now it's Plasmashell using about 21% and xdg-document-portal using about 13%. There's still some activity with kwin_wayland, but only 4-5%. And Plasmashell doesn't seem to want to crash or core dump anymore. The high CPU usage can still be triggered and stopped repeatedly by just un-selecting some text, and selecting some new text.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
